xen/arm: Divide GIC initialization in 2 parts

Currently the function to translate IRQ from the device tree is set
unconditionally  to be able to be able to retrieve serial/timer IRQ before the
GIC has been initialized.

It assumes that the xlate function won't ever changed. We may also need to
have the primary interrupt controller very early.

Rework the gic initialization in 2 parts:
    - gic_preinit: Get the interrupt controller device tree node and set
up GIC and xlate callbacks
    - gic_init: Initialize the interrupt controller and the boot CPU
    interrupts.

The former function will be called just after the IRQ subsystem as been
initialized.
